null

T-Mount f/NEX

$23.95
Write a Review
SKU:
ACE63160
UPC:
034447008909
MPN
DL-0888P

Store Availability:

SKU
ACE63160
AshburnFalls Church
In stockOut of stock

Description

Reviews

Ask our experts